Beryl Properties
| Chemical Composition | It is beryllium aluminum silicate and the chemical formula is Be3Al2Si6O18. |
| Colours | Colourless, green, sea blue, violet, pink, red, blue, yellow, golden, gray, purple, brown and white. |
| Streak | White |
| Variety | Emerald, Aquamarine, Morganite, Heliodor, Goshenite, Bixbite |
| Specific Gravity | 2.36-2.91 |
| Refractive Index | Varies between 1.57-1.59. |
| Luster | Viterous. |
| Solid State | Transparent to translucent. |
| Fractures | Conchoidal. |
| Bi-refringence | Low – 0.005-0.009 |
| Crystal System | Hexagonal crystal system. |
| Cleavage | Imperfect. |
| Pleochroism | Weak. |
| Dispersion | Low – 0.014 |
| Hardness | 7.5-8 Mohs |
| Heat Sensitive | Very high. |
| Tenacity | Brittle |
| Precautions | All general gemstone precautions to be taken. Special attention to be given at the time of repair work. |
| Enhancement | Mostly all the gemstones are enhanced to improve the colour. |
| Source | Egypt, Austria, Africa, Pakistan, Ireland, Germany, Brazil, Russia, Colombia, Zambia, Mozambique, Angola, Nigeria, Mungo, Baltistan, Pakistan, United States of America, South Africa, United Kingdom. |
